Output 35642c3524ef47da8c415f0b0df3bfc501204c09a620aa24acf94da0b7825d23:18

value
1460800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e55a5b5a659a8eaeb8702536149466c5837705 OP_EQUAL
address
ABfPKPyUEtCNQJ1Hpr8CX7Cry4HQX3Rj23
transaction
35642c3524ef47da8c415f0b0df3bfc501204c09a620aa24acf94da0b7825d23